Abstract | The School of Dentistry of the University of North Carolina at Chapel Hill was established by the North Carolina General Assembly in 1949. The school's Office of Institutional and Community Relations administered the continuing education program, which was funded through the North Carolina Area Health Education Centers Program (AHEC). Records consist of materials related to the School of Dentistry's continuing education program. Included are continuing education course catalogs, annual and quarterly reports, and planning materials. |
